Intramedullary spinal cord tumours – a single Centre, 10-year review of clinical and pathological outcomes

Abstract

Background

Intramedullary spinal cord tumours are relatively rare tumours of the central nervous system. Surgical outcomes are affected by many variables, including pre-operative neurological function, tumour histology and extent of resection. Emphasis remains on surgical treatment due to limited adjunctive therapeutic options and poor drug penetration.

Objective

To identify clinically relevant predictors of progression free survival by retrospectively analysing the extent of resection, pre- and post-operative neurological function and histology in intramedullary spinal cord tumours from a single neurosurgical centre over 10 years.

Methods

Forty-three adult cases were identified from a surgical database. Variables collected included pre-and post-operative Frankel Grade and Modified McCormick Scale assessments, tumour histology, extent of resection and length of follow up. Chi-Squared, Kaplan–Mier Survival and Mann–Whitney U-tests were completed.

Results

Ependymoma (41.9%) and haemangioblastoma (14.0%) were the commonest tumour histologies. In total, 17 different histological tumours were identified in the series. There was a statistically significant relationship between identification of the tumour plane and extent of resection (p < 0.01), along with the extent of resection and recurrence (p = 0.04). Compared to the other histological subtypes, ependymoma’s demonstrated a significantly greater extent of resection (p = 0.01). There was a significant relationship between the grade of tumour and progression-free survival (p < 0.01).

Conclusion

Tumour plane and the extent of tumour resection are significant determinants of progression-free survival. Ependymoma, whilst being the commonest histology in our series were also the most resectable. Whilst complete resection reduces the rate of recurrence, tumour grade is the most important predictor of outcome. Given the importance of the extent of resection, and following a similar trend to other low volume pathologies, these tumours should only be tackled by neurosurgeons with experience in their resection.
